SDG-Oriented Action Planning for Cities Supported by the City Prosperity Initiative, IUTC

April 2017 — This training course was a collaboration of UN-Habitat and the International Urban Training Centre (IUTC).  It drew on knowledge and experience of the City Prosperity Initiative (CPI) developed by UN-Habitat as a tool to measure different dimensions of prosperity in cities, as well as to serve as a platform for policy dialogue and action planning for cities.  The goal of the course was to develop understanding of urban indicators and its application for policy making, action planning and implementation that have direct impact on the spatial structure of cities and its prosperity.  The workshop also introduced the various dimensions of the City Prosperity Index and their policy implications. The workshop was tailored to the needs of senior decision makers and executive staff of municipal and regional governments involved in urban planning and management of cities, mostly from the Asia-Pacific region.
